BMW front end clip - office desks(!)...
A friend of mine(Danke Flo!) showed me this cool FB page. Seems there is an indy BMW repair shop in Bucharest, Romania - that has some very special office desks!
They took the front end clips of various BMW models and made desks(!) out of them! It's brilliant! This shop looks small but its obvious they have a lot of LOVE for BMW's.
